I have customer who would like to have ssh and telnet start earilier, 
say in milestone multi-user instead of multi-user-server or all.

I see from Liane's blog 
(http://blogs.sun.com/roller/page/lianep?entry=starting_ssh_early_in_boot) 
, the dependencies to remove in order to get ssh to start as early as 
single user.
As far as the telnet service, it has no dependencies but is part of the 
inetd restarter which does have dependencies.

Is it safe to remove any of inetd's dependencies in order to start 
telnet earlier say in milestone-user ?
Is there a means thru svccfg to change what milestone a service starts in ?

And yes... I'm trying to relay to the customer that init & rc scripts 
align differently to milestones and services.
